a       { color: #3399cc; text-decoration: none; }
a:hover { color: #00b0e9; }

body
{
	height: 100%;
	margin: 0;
	padding: 0;
	background-color: #000;
}

#grayContainer 
{	
	font-family: Verdana, Geneva, Arial, sans-serif;
	background: url(/beendo/images/corners/background.gif);
	margin-left: -500px;
	position: absolute;
	top: -0px;
	left: 50%;
	width: 1000px;
	height: 800px;
	visibility: visible
	text-align: center;
}

#whiteContainer 
{
	background: url('/beendo/images/corners/white_g_mid.gif') repeat;
	position: absolute;
	left: 50%;
	top: 0px;
	width: 850px;
	height: 640px;
	margin-left: -425px;
	
}

#whiteContainer #whiteBottom {
	color:#fff;
	background: url('/beendo/images/corners/white_g_BOT.gif') no-repeat bottom;
	width: 850px;
	height: 42px;
	text-align: left;
	position: absolute;
	left:0;
	bottom:0px;
	
	
}

#footerDiv
{
	width: 850px;
	margin-left: -400px;
	position: absolute;
	left: 50%;
	top: 650px;
}


*html #contents
{
	width: 830px;
	position: absolute;
	left: 10px;
	top: 75px;
}

#contents
{
	width: 830px;
	position: absolute;
	left: 10px;
	top: 75px;
}

#leftTopBox
{
	width: 500px;
}

.rbroundboxGRAY { background: url('/beendo/images/corners/gray_BG.gif') repeat; }
.rbtopGRAY div { background: url('/beendo/images/corners/gray_w_TL.gif') no-repeat top left; }
.rbtopGRAY { background: url('/beendo/images/corners/gray_w_TR.gif') no-repeat top right; }
.rbbotGRAY div { background: url('/beendo/images/corners/gray_w_BL.gif') no-repeat bottom left; }
.rbbotGRAY { background: url('/beendo/images/corners/gray_w_BR.gif') no-repeat bottom right; }

#filler 
{
	height:185px;
}


*#sixPXSpacer
{
	height:3px;
	visibility: visible;
	display: block;
	background-color: #fff;
}


#leftBottomBox
{
	width: 500px;
	margin: 3px 0px 0px 0px;
	background: url('/beendo/images/corners/blue_BG.gif') repeat;
	overflow: hidden; 
}

.rbroundboxBLUE_W { background: url('/beendo/images/corners/blue_BG.gif') repeat; }
.rbtopBLUE_W div { background: url('/beendo/images/corners/blue_w_TL.gif') no-repeat top left; }
.rbtopBLUE_W { background: url('/beendo/images/corners/blue_w_TR.gif') no-repeat top right; }
.rbbotBLUE_W div { background: url('/beendo/images/corners/blue_w_BL.gif') no-repeat bottom left; }
.rbbotBLUE_W { background: url('/beendo/images/corners/blue_w_BR.gif') no-repeat bottom right; }

#filler2 
{
	margin:0;
	height:175px;
	padding:0px 25px 10px;
}





div#rightBox 
{
      	position: absolute;
      	left: 506px;
      	top: 0px;
      	width: 321px;
      	background: url('/beendo/images/corners/blue_BG.gif') repeat; 
}

#filler3
{
	margin:0;
	height:409px;
}



#loginBox
{
	width: 275px;
	background:transparent url('/beendo/images/corners/loginBODY.gif') repeat-y;
	position: absolute;
	left: 20px;

}

#loginBox #loginBoxTop
{
	background:transparent url('/beendo/images/corners/loginTOP.gif') no-repeat;
	width:100%;
}

#loginBox #loginBoxContent
{
	
	height: 190px;
	margin:0;
	padding:0px 10px 0px;
}

#loginBox #loginBoxBottom
{
	background:transparent url('/beendo/images/corners/loginBOTTOM.gif') no-repeat bottom;
	width: 100%;
}

.style1 
{
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14pt;
	color: #333333;
}

.style2 
{
	font-family: Helvetica;
	font-size: 16pt;
	color: #FFFFFF;
}

.style3 
{
	font-family: Helvetica;
	color: #ECF9FD;	
}

.style5
{
	font-family: Helvetica;
	color: #ffffff;
	font-size: 12px;
}

.style6
{
	font-family: Helvetica;
	color: #ffffff;
	font-size:16px;
}

.style7 
{
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10pt;
	color: #ffffff;
}

.style8
{
	font-family: Helvetica;
	color: #666666;
	font-size:12px;
}

.style9
{
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10pt;
	color: #333333;
}

.style4 {font-size: 18px}
.style11 {font-family: Helvetica}
.style12 {font-size: 10pt}


a.btn1            { background: url(/beendo/images/btn_bg1.gif) no-repeat 0 0px; color: #666; text-decoration: none; display: block; float: left; padding-left: 3px; margin: 0 4px; }
a:hover.btn1      { background-position: 0 -19px; color: #fafafa; }
a.btn1 span       { background: url(/beendo/images/btn_bg1.gif) no-repeat 100% 0px; float: left; padding: 3px 19px 0 16px; height: 16px; }
a:hover.btn1 span { background-position: 100% -19px; cursor: hand; }
a.btn1narrow span { padding: 3px 12px 0 9px; }



a.btn2            { background: url(/beendo/images/btn_bg2.gif) no-repeat 0 0px; color: #666; text-decoration: none; display: block; float: left; padding-left: 3px; margin: 0px; }
a:hover.btn2      { background-position: 0 -19px; }
a.btn2 span  { background: url(/beendo/images/btn_bg2.gif) no-repeat 100% 0px; float: left; padding: 3px 19px 0 16px; height: 16px; }
a:hover.btn2 span { background-position: 100% -19px; cursor: hand; }

a.btn3            { background: url(/beendo/images/button2.jpg) no-repeat 0 0px; background-position: 100% -19px; color: #666; text-decoration: none; display: block; float: left; padding-left: 0px; margin: 0 4px; }
a:hover.btn3      { background-position: 0 -19px; }
a.btn3 span       { background: url(/beendo/images/button2.jpg) no-repeat 100% 0px; float: left; padding: 3px 19px 0 0px; height: 16px; }
a:hover.btn3 span { background-position: 100% 0px; cursor: hand; }

.footer_text
{  
   font-family: Helvetica;
   font-size: 11px;  
   color: #CCCCCC;
   text-decoration:none;
}

.footer_text a:hover
{  
   font-family: Helvetica;
   font-size: 11px;  
   color: #CCCCCC;
   text-decoration:underline;
}

.contactAddLabel1	{ width: 200px; }
.contactAddInput	{ width: 240px; margin: 0 3px 0px 0px; }
.contactAddInputCity	{ width: 148px; margin: 0 3px 0px 0px; }
.contactAddInputState	{ width: 20px; margin: 0 3px 0px 0px; }
.contactAddInputZip	{ width: 60px; margin: 0 3px 0px 0px; }
.contactAddInputCountry	{ width: 60px; margin: 0 3px 0px 0px; }
.contactAdd table	{ padding: 0; margin: 0; border-collapse: collapse; width: 880px; }
.contactAdd td		{ padding: 2px 0; }

.loginInput   { width: 170px; }
